Four-Time Pro Bowler Signs Contract With Dallas Cowboys
NFL veteran running back Dalvin Cook signed a new contract with the Dallas Cowboys. Cook split the 2023 season between the New York Jets and Baltimore Ravens but has most notably played for the Minnesota Vikings. Four-time Pro Bowl RB Dalvin Cook is signing with the #Cowboys, per his agency LAA. Cook was waiting for the right opportunity and always felt it was Dallas.
